A power series is a type of series with terms involving a variable. More specifically, if the variable is x, then all the terms of the series involve powers of x. As a result, a power series can be thought ... feed store aspermont txWebNov 16, 2024 · A power series about a, or just power series, is any series that can be written in the form, ∞ ∑ n=0cn(x −a)n ∑ n = 0 ∞ c n ( x − a) n. where a a and cn c n are numbers. The cn c n ’s are often called the coefficients of the series.
